#ifndef VK_SEMAPHORE_H
#define VK_SEMAPHORE_H

#include "vk_object.h"
#include "vk_sync.h"

#ifdef __cplusplus
extern "C" {
#endif

struct vk_sync;

struct vk_semaphore {
   struct vk_object_base base;

   /** VkSemaphoreTypeCreateInfo::semaphoreType */
   VkSemaphoreType type;

   /* Temporary semaphore state.
    *
    * A semaphore *may* have temporary state.  That state is added to the
    * semaphore by an import operation and is reset back to NULL when the
    * semaphore is reset.  A semaphore with temporary state cannot be signaled
    * because the semaphore must already be signaled before the temporary
    * state can be exported from the semaphore in the other process and
    * imported here.
    */
   struct vk_sync *temporary;

   /** Permanent semaphore state.
    *
    * Every semaphore has some form of permanent state.
    *
    * This field must be last
    */
   alignas(8) struct vk_sync permanent;
};

VK_DEFINE_NONDISP_HANDLE_CASTS(vk_semaphore, base, VkSemaphore,
                               VK_OBJECT_TYPE_SEMAPHORE);

void vk_semaphore_reset_temporary(struct vk_device *device,
                                  struct vk_semaphore *semaphore);

static inline struct vk_sync *
vk_semaphore_get_active_sync(struct vk_semaphore *semaphore)
{
   return semaphore->temporary ? semaphore->temporary : &semaphore->permanent;
}

#ifdef __cplusplus
}
#endif

#endif /* VK_SEMAPHORE_H */
